Good nutrition is essential to brain function. Although all
school breakfasts would not be considered wholesome, they do
provide some nourishment to the student who chooses to have
them. Parents are working, on the go, and children are often
left to fend for themselves in the kitchen. If the cereal
box is empty, many children are happy that their school provides
a breakfast. Most of the breakfast menus I have seen have been
Pop Tarts, pancakes with syrup, milk, sometimes scrambled eggs
with bacon and toast, Granola bars, a nutrition donut coated
with a small amount of glaze, orange juice, or grape juice. Yes,
the breakfasts I have seen have been limited in many ways. Not
very much has gone into the preparation, and some students omit
them.
School breakfasts provide options for children who did not have
one at home, or for some reason did not like what was being
served. They are relatively quick, limited in choices, and often
loaded with sugar. I am sure this is not the case everywhere,
however, where I have been, this was the case.
Parents appreciate these fill-ins for their children. At least
knowing that their children have something to eat before lunch
is a reassuring thought. In large families, food is consumed
very quickly, and some parents rely on the school breakfast to
augment their supply of food for their families. In these cases,
school breaksfasts are a necessity. It is never known whether or
not the school is the only supplier of food for a child.
Children who do not get enough nutritious food to eat become
listless, or moody, or some become just plain mean. After they
have something to eat, they become calmer. The brain operates
best when they partake of breakfast.
I personally would like to see a wider variety of foods offered
at breakfast time. I would like to see more fruit and less
sugar content in the menu. I would like to see whole grain cereals
with reduced amounts of sugar offered also. Students should be
encouraged to try new breakfast foods over a relative time period.
Choices that are totally unpopular should be removed from the menu
and replaced with those foods that children prefer.
In some areas where jobs are scarce, and the economy down, the
school breakfast can bring great happiness to those who need it.
I see it as a great service, and one that should always be in place.
